Orca slicer is a smart and easy-to-use tool made for people who love 3D printing. It helps turn your 3D models into printer-ready files in just a few steps. With orca slicer software, you can prepare, adjust, and control your prints with better accuracy and speed. It is designed for beginners and professionals who want smooth printing results without stress.
One of the best things about orca slicer software is its clean interface. Everything is easy to find. You can import your 3D model, adjust the print settings, and preview the final result before printing. This helps reduce mistakes and saves both time and filament. Even if you are new to 3D printing, the software guides you clearly.
The orca slicer official website provides all the latest updates, downloads, and helpful guides. You can find detailed instructions, feature explanations, and community support there. The website also keeps users informed about new improvements and performance updates.
Another strong feature of orca slicer is its advanced slicing engine. It offers fast processing and detailed layer control. Users can adjust layer height, infill patterns, print speed, temperature, and many other settings. This level of control allows high-quality prints with smooth surfaces and strong structures.

How Orca Slicer Improves Print Quality
Quality depends on precision. We provide tools that allow users to control:
Seam placement
Overhang management
Bridging settings
Support density
Flow calibration
With proper adjustments, prints become cleaner and stronger. Surfaces look smoother, and mechanical parts fit better.
Our software also helps reduce common problems such as:
Stringing
Warping
Under-extrusion
Over-extrusion
By adjusting settings directly inside orca slicer, users gain full control over their print results.

Support for Advanced Users
While we keep the interface simple, we also provide deep customization for advanced users. These include:
Custom G-code editing
Acceleration and jerk control
Pressure advance adjustments
Cooling fan curves
